How far is 17,874 steps? About 8.94 miles, using the standard 2,000-steps-per-mile conversion. For a real-world comparison, think of a full day of sightseeing on foot in a major city. That's roughly 203% of what NHANES data shows the average American walks each day (8,818 steps).

17,874 Steps to Miles, By Height

The 2,000-steps-per-mile figure above is a flat average. Stride length actually scales with height, so the same 17,874 steps covers a different distance depending on how tall the walker is.

HeightDistance
Short (~5'2")7.24 mi
Average (~5'7")7.82 mi
Tall (~6'2")8.64 mi

Where 17,874 Steps Ranks

Activity levels are commonly grouped by daily step count. Here's where 17,874 steps falls.

Activity LevelDaily Steps
SedentaryUnder 5,000
Low Active5,000–7,499
Somewhat Active7,500–9,999
Active10,000–12,499
Highly Active12,500+

The most popular route of the Camino de Santiago, a pilgrimage walked for over a thousand years, is nearly 500 miles and usually takes about a month on foot, a tradition that predates GPS, cushioned sneakers, and the modern mile itself.

Stride length naturally shortens with age, along with more time spent with both feet on the ground at once. Researchers sometimes use gait speed alone as a simple, low-cost marker of overall health in older adults.

Is 17,874 steps a lot?

It's more than the average U.S. adult walks in a day. 17,874 steps is about 203% of the NHANES-measured daily average of 8,818 steps.

How long does it take to walk 17,874 steps?

At an average walking pace of about 3 mph, 17,874 steps takes roughly 2 hr 59 min. Walking slower or faster will shift that time up or down.
